Uterine Involution and Reproductive Performance in Dairy Cows with Metabolic Diseases

摘要

The aim of this study was to investigate the effects of metabolic diseases on uterine involution and reproductive performance during the postpartum period. Multiparous Holstein dairy cows ( n = 50) were divided into four groups based on whether they were healthy ( n = 14), or had lipomobilization ( n = 14), hypocalcemia ( n = 11), and hyperketonemia ( n = 11). Transrectal palpation and transrectal B-Mode sonography were carried out on days 7, 14, 21, 30, 45 and 60 after parturition. Cows with metabolic disease had a greater ( p 0.05) uterine size as assessed transrectally compared with cows without metabolic disease. Sonographic measurements revealed a greater ( p 0.05) horn diameter and endometrial thickness in cows of the metabolic disease groups than in the healthy cows. Metabolic disease affected ( p 0.05) the milk yield, percentage of service per pregnancy, days to first ovulation and days open. In conclusion, metabolic disease affected the uterine involution and fertility during the postpartum period.
